Usually, these communities aren’t-for-profit otherwise are belonging to people or buyers that more concerned about the commercial and you will societal growth of the indegent than just he or she is that have earnings. The largest of those societal objective microfinanciers tend to be Possibility International, Finca Internationally, Accion Around the globe, Oikocredit, and Grameen Bank.

Compared with nonprofit teams, industrial financial institutions that produce microloans generally bring simply financial features. Particular large commercial banks, for instance the Indian bank ICICI, do not give right to private microcredit readers, but rather function with brief microfinance teams.

Another innovation that lots of nonprofit microfinance teams features used try concentrating on women. On Grameen Bank, such as for instance, 97 per cent from clients are females as the “lady have prolonged eyes [and] need to alter their existence alot more intensively,” says Yunus. 5 On top of that, “men are a great deal more callous having money.” 6 Research indeed implies that when people retain power over microloans, they spend more on the health, safeguards, and you may passion of their families. 7

A major benefit of microfinance is actually its so-called ability to encourage female. Research shows one to microcredit develops ladies’ bargaining strength in the family, centrality on area, focus on personal and you can governmental activities, and you will flexibility. it grows the worry about-respect and you may notice-really worth. 8 Yet , microcredit alone never beat ingrained patriarchal systems from handle. Regardless of accessing borrowing, some female microcredit clients don’t have power over the new loans developed or perhaps the money made by the new microenterprises. 9 Complete, microcredit really does empower female, but merely for the noneconomic suggests.

Inspite of the hoopla related microcredit, partners has actually learnt their feeling. ten One of the most complete knowledge is at a surprising achievement: Microloans are more best for individuals way of life over the poverty range than to individuals life below the impoverishment line. eleven The reason being clients with income are able to use the threats, such as for example investing the newest tech, that will most likely improve earnings streams. Terrible individuals, on the other hand, often take out old-fashioned loans you to definitely protect their subsistence, and you may barely invest in the fresh new technology, fixed financing, or the choosing out-of labor.

Microloans perhaps even treat cash flow on poorest of one’s poor, observes Vijay Mahajan, the main exec from Basix, an enthusiastic Indian outlying financing place. The guy concludes that microcredit “generally seems to create more damage than simply good to the fresh new poorest.” several One to reason may be the large interest rates charged from the microcredit organizations. Acleda, a great Cambodian commercial bank devoted to microcredit, charges interest levels of approximately 2 percent to help you cuatro.5 per cent monthly. Additional microlenders charge way more, driving extremely annual rates so you can anywhere between 30 percent and you can 60 percent. 13 Microcredit proponents argue that this type of cost, whether or not highest, will still be well less than those people billed of the casual moneylenders. Another problem with microcredit is the people it is designed to finance. An excellent microcredit visitors is actually operator throughout the literal feel: She enhances the investment, takes care of the company, and you will takes household the gains. Nevertheless the “entrepreneurs” with be heroes regarding the created business are visionaries exactly who move the newest ideas for the winning company activities. Although some microcredit members are creating visionary businesses, a large proportion is actually stuck for the subsistence facts. They will have zero formal feel, and therefore need certainly to compete with all other mind-operating poor people inside admission-top trades. 14 Most have no paid personnel, very own couple assets, and you will perform on too tiny a size to achieve efficiencies, and therefore generate really meager money. Quite simply, extremely microenterprises was smaller than average of numerous falter – up against the United Nations’ buzz you to microentrepreneurs will grow enduring firms that cause thriving economic climates.
